Expert 5K+ Posts: 9666 Location: So. Cal | Most people here use KYB 4507 for the later C-bodies on the front. You have to cut the metal bushings at the bottom of them, but they work really well. The rears use shocks from an A-body Dart or Valiant. https://www.summitracing.com/parts/kyb-kg4507 Edited by Powerflite 2018-09-12 10:50 AM | ||
